YC57 KPJ is a 2008 Chrysler-jeep 300 in Silver with a 2,987c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 65.2%.
Across all 2008 Chrysler-jeep 300 models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.0% with a typical mileage of 78,753 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Chrysler-jeep 300 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 8,438 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YC57 KPJ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Chrysler-jeep 300 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 18 years old, this Chrysler-jeep 300 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
